어제 ssl 적용까지 했는데 급하게 퇴근하는 바람에 오늘 기록용으로 적게 됨

약간 야매st로 한거라 인증서가 이렇게 나옴

주소 뒤쪽에 port num 입력한 것은 인증서가 안뜸
url 앞쪽에 https:// 를 안붙이면 아예 접속이 안됨
ssl 적용을 위해선
crt, key가 필요하고 key는 password 없는 것도 있어야 함

가린건 사내에서 사용하는 명칭이 따로 있어서 가렸고 nginx에 포트를 80:80, 443:443으로 연결시켜주었다


nginx.conf 파일 ssl 부분으로 crt, key 파일과 연결시켜줌
ssl_protocols TLSv1.2;
ssl_certificate /etc/nginx/star_@@_NginX/server_crt.pem;
ssl_certificate_key /etc/nginx/star_@@_NginX/ssl_nopasswd_key.pem;
대략 이런 식으로?
대략 한달간 도커 가상화 작업을 끝냈다
처음엔 리눅스 명령어도 어색했는데 이젠 구글링으로 조금은 다져졌다고 할 수 있으려나 ㅋㅋ
vmware 설치 > centos 7 설치 > centos7안에 docker 설치 > docker-compose도 설치해야 함 > NW 설정 > 포트 열어주기 > docker, container 설치 > db(mariaDB) 긁어오기 > jdk(open JDK) 설치 > SSL(openssl) 설정
이 순서로 작업 한듯
중간중간 패키지 설치(yum) , 톰캣, WAS도..
처음엔 엄청 헤맸음 도커 image안에 컨테이너 형태로 띄워져야 하는데 nginx를 리눅스에 바로 깔아버리거나..ㅋㅋ 온갖 오류로 구글링을 생활화 했었음
db까지는 어느정도 매뉴얼이 있어서 따라하면서 배우는 정도? 근데 그 외의 것들은 혼자 구글링 하면서 찾아보고 지워보고 다시 다운로드 해보고 로그 찍어보고... 개발하면서 느낀 점은 로그를 찍어봐야 안다는 것 !!
앞으로 쿠버네티스도 할줄 알아야된다고 해서 각잡고 배워볼 예정.. 백엔드 하려면 이 정도는 해야 하는게 당연(?) 하니까..
'개발 관련' 카테고리의 다른 글
| attr, prop 차이 (0) | 2023.04.19 |
|---|---|
| 리눅스Linux 자주 쓰는 명령어 (0) | 2022.09.27 |
| centos ssl 개인키에서 패스워드 제거하기 (0) | 2022.06.02 |
| linux로 tar파일 옮기기 (0) | 2022.05.30 |
| linux로 war파일 옮기기 (0) | 2022.05.27 |